Architectural Wonders: Unveiling the Stunning Features That Make It a Real Estate Jewel

Douglas

The Gadsden Hotel stands as a testament to architectural excellence, boasting a stunning blend of historical charm and modern elegance that makes it a real estate gem. From its grand entranceway, adorned with intricate carvings and ornate details, to the meticulously preserved period furnishings inside, every aspect of this landmark property tells a story. The hotel’s facade showcases beautiful architectural wonders, featuring classic columns, elegant archways, and symmetrical design elements that capture the essence of its era.

Stepping into the lobby, visitors are greeted by high ceilings, grand chandeliers, and a sweeping staircase that exudes opulence and sophistication. The interior spaces are meticulously designed, with rich wood paneling, marble flooring, and custom-made fixtures that reflect the craftsmanship of yesteryear. These architectural marvels not only contribute to the hotel’s aesthetic appeal but also create an immersive experience for guests, transporting them back in time while offering modern conveniences.
